Underground Coal Mining Methods and Engineering Dust …
By 2015, underground mining accounted for only 35 percent of U.S. coal production. The amount mined was 300 million tons; longwall mining and room-and-pillar continuous mining accounted for about 60 and 39 percent of that production, respectively. ... Mining Engineering BS Degree | College of Engineering
Mining engineers design, plan, and supervise surface and underground mines to unearth the minerals economically and safely for further processing and human use.
